I have posted a few times on here over the last year to try find more history on my car, and i have found a lot, but the most interesting years is still missing. I need help from local racers/rodders around the places i mention below to track down people who might have valuable information. Car is supposed to have ran in Top Fuel - Florida is mentioned several times as the origin (not exactly sure what years any more - was told 1967 at first, then 1969 and a few years forward, but might be earlier, anyway some time in the sixties). Doesnt really matter maybe... But - what i have found out/heard, is that it ran an injected Hemi in the late sixties - located around NEW HAMPSHIRE. Then it was sold to a guy named Murray in 1974`ish, wich didnt tell me anything usefull for a long time, but it just came to my attention that there was/is? a guy named Ken Murray from Winnipeg, Canada, that used to race Top Alcohol Dragster (including Front Engine dragsters) in the early 70`s. Im not sure its the same guy, but its something i would like to check out. Car is a 180" wheelbase today, but before late 70`s it was a shorter wheelbase car with a chutepack (it was rebuilt late 70`s). A town named Dorval, Canada, has also popped up, and its said that it was stored there for a while at an Airport storage (if i have gotten it right). This is also before the car was rebuilt to a longer wheelbase and chutepack removed. I am interested in getting in touch with people who where around these areas and maybe remember names, cars, teams, and that might point me in the right direction. Dorval is a suburb of Montreal, Quebec where the Montreal airport is located so that part makes sense. The Sanair dragstrip opened there in 1970 and hosted NHRA events back in the day, you might try contacting them
